God and Man?


Someone says, “How can this be? He was the ‘God-Man’!”
If He was not a man – who was the Babe in Bethlehem’s manger?
If He was not God – why did a choir of angels come down from Heaven and sing at His birth?
If He was not a man – who called Himself “the Son of man”?
If He was not God – who said, “I and my Father are one”?
If He was not a man – who washed the disciples’ feet?
If He was not God – who washed them from their sins in His own blood?
If He was not a man – who was it that wept at Lazarus’ tomb?
If He was not God – who called Lazarus forth from the tomb?
If He was not a man – who hungered on the mountainside?
If He was not God – who fed a hungry multitude on that same mountainside with a little boy’s lunch?
If He was not a man – who stood before Pilate when Pilate said, “Behold the man”?
If He was not God – who caused Pilate to wash his hands and say, “I find no fault in this man”?
If He was not a man – whose hands and feet were nailed to the cross?
If He was not God – who rent the veil in the temple?
If He was not a man – who hung on the cross?
If He was not God – who moved the earth from its foundations?
If He was not a man – who cried out from the cross, “I thirst”?
If He was not God – who gave the woman at the well living water?
If He was not a man – who cried out, “My God, My God, why hast thou forsaken me?”
If He was not God – who said, “Father, forgive them; for they know not what they do”?
If He was not a man – who was buried in Joseph’s tomb?
If He was not God – who cam forth from the same tomb three days later?
I say to you today, HE WAS MAN! HE WAS GOD! HE WAS THE GOD-MAN,
And He is mine!

by Clyde Box

fasting by Hockett

When this idea of fasting came to me I really didn’t know what to do about it. I knew from the examples in the Bible, that fasting was something that is done to sacrifice your body to bring glory to God. I quickly realized that my definition of fasting was somewhat vague, so I had to do a little research. I decided to ask around and the information I gathered from The Bible, internet articles and a good friend of mine blew me away. My friend shared with me some things that helped me understand how fasting can change your spritual life and improve your relationship with God. He said that fasting shows our reliance upon God for all things. It reminds us that we are, ultimately, spiritual beings. But yet how often do we neglect to remember God’s presence when we would never consider neglecting to eat! Fasting brings us face to face with how we put the material world ahead of its spiritual source.

If the point of the fast is to deny our physical senses and to focus on our spirituality, then it would be pointless to deny my body food but satisfy my flesh by physical pleasure. We are just satisfying our flesh in a different way, and in doing so missing the entire point of the fast. When you fast, replace all things physical with all things spiritual. If any activity is satisfying to your flesh, deny it during your periods of fasting for the greatest possible benefit to your spirit. The statement by Sun-Kyung Cho, sister of Seung-Hui Cho, on behalf of herself and her family:

On behalf of our family, we are so deeply sorry for the devastation my brother has caused. No words can express our sadness that 32 innocent people lost their lives this week in such a terrible, senseless tragedy. We are heartbroken.We grieve alongside the families, the Virginia Tech community, our State of Virginia, and the rest of the nation. And, the world.

Every day since April 16, my father, mother and I pray for students Ross Abdallah Alameddine, Brian Roy Bluhm, Ryan Christopher Clark, Austin Michelle Cloyd, Matthew Gregory Gwaltney, Caitlin Millar Hammaren, Jeremy Michael Herbstritt, Rachael Elizabeth Hill, Emily Jane Hilscher, Jarrett Lee Lane, Matthew Joseph La Porte, Henry J. Lee, Partahi Mamora Halomoan Lumbantoruan, Lauren Ashley McCain, Daniel Patrick O'Neil, J. Ortiz-Ortiz, Minal Hiralal Panchal, Daniel Alejandro Perez, Erin Nicole Peterson, Michael Steven Pohle, Jr., Julia Kathleen Pryde, Mary Karen Read, Reema Joseph Samaha, Waleed Mohamed Shaalan, Leslie Geraldine Sherman, Maxine Shelly Turner, Nicole White, Instructor Christopher James Bishop, and Professors Jocelyne Couture-Nowak, Kevin P. Granata, Liviu Librescu and G.V. Loganathan.

We pray for their families and loved ones who are experiencing so much excruciating grief. And we pray for those who were injured and for those whose lives are changed forever because of what they witnessed and experienced. Each of these people had so much love, talent and gifts to offer, and their lives were cut short by a horrible and senseless act.

We are humbled by this darkness. We feel hopeless, helpless and lost. This is someone that I grew up with and loved. Now I feel like I didn't know this person. We have always been a close, peaceful and loving family. My brother was quiet and reserved, yet struggled to fit in. We never could have envisioned that he was capable of so much violence. He has made the world weep. We are living a nightmare.

There is much justified anger and disbelief at what my brother did, and a lot of questions are left unanswered. Our family will continue to cooperate fully and do whatever we can to help authorities understand why these senseless acts happened. We have many unanswered questions as well.

Our family is so very sorry for my brother's unspeakable actions. It is a terrible tragedy for all of us.
